
Cost of Floor Slab Installation in Vancouver
When considering the cost of floor slab installation in Vancouver, WA, it's essential to understand the various factors that influence pricing. Vancouver's unique climate and soil conditions, along with local labor rates, can significantly impact the overall expense. This guide will help you navigate the costs associated with installing a floor slab in this region.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Slab: Larger slabs require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ials such as reinforced concrete or specialty finishes will raise the price.
- Site Preparation: The need for excavation, grading, or clearing can add to the initial costs.
- Labor Rates: Local labor costs in Vancouver, WA, can vary, affecting the total expense.
- Permits and Inspections: Fees for necessary permits and inspections can add to the project cost.
- Complexity of Design: Intricate designs or custom shapes may require additional labor and materials.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can impact the timeline and cost due to potential delays.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Vancouver, WA)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Slab (per sq ft) | $6 - $8 |
Reinforced Concrete Slab | $8 - $12 |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Excavation | $800 - $2,000 |
Grading | $500 - $1,500 |
Permits and Inspections | $200 - $500 |
Finishing and Sealing | $2 - $4 per sq ft |
Custom Design Elements | $10 - $15 per sq ft |
